Status of the Kakin Princes (Latest Chapter)
| Rank | Name | Status | Details |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Benjamin | Alive | In the incubation period after exposure to a bio-weapon |
| 2 | Camilla | Alive | Failed to kill Benjamin and is now detained |
| 3 | Zhang Lei | Alive | - |
| 4 | Tserriednich | Alive | - |
| 5 | Tubeppa | Alive | - |
| 6 | Tyson | Alive | - |
| 7 | Luzurus | Alive | - |
| 8 | Sale-Sale | Dead | - |
| 9 | Halkenburg | Dead | The body is dead, but his personality lives on in First Prince’s guard captain Balsamilco |
| 10 | Kacho | Dead | Guardian beast is still alive |
| 11 | Fugetsu | Alive | - |
| 12 | Momoze | Dead | - |
| 13 | Marayam | Alive | - |
| 14 | Woble | Alive | Not aboard the ship |

2026-07-13 Chapter 413 Loyalty
Synopsis: Benjamin informs his private soldiers that special martial law will be declared. 15 minutes to go.
Huyricov’s words are probably true. If the goal were simply to kill Prince Benjamin, there would be no need for such an elaborate scheme, and a simple curse kill would be enough.
What I keep wondering about, though, is which princes Benjamin meant in Volume 39 when he thought at the 40-minute mark after the declaration of martial law that “four princes remain.” At this point, there are nine princes other than Benjamin that are recognized as alive. Of these, the princes under control and not considered threats are Prince Camilla and the three below Prince Fugetsu, leaving five after subtracting them. Those five are the Third Prince Zhang Lei through the Seventh Prince Luzurus. And since the Third and Seventh Princes are unaccounted for after the declaration, if they are included among the remaining princes, then the other two must be among the three from the Fourth Prince Tserriednich through the Sixth Prince Tyson. In other words, one of these three is already either dealt with or in a state where being dealt with is confirmed.
And this time, Benjamin makes it clear that he will handle the Second Prince and the Fourth Prince himself when he says, “Leave the Second Prince and the Fourth Prince to me.” Since almost an hour has passed since the declaration of martial law, it is hard to think he would leave them for later, so I suspect that Camilla, who is already detained, has been dealt with, and Tserriednich, who does not seem likely to be taken down easily in terms of either personality or ability, has also already been dealt with, or Benjamin is mistaken and thinks he has already been dealt with. In conclusion, I think the “four princes remaining” refers to the unaccounted-for Third Prince Zhang Lei and Seventh Prince Luzurus, along with the still-undealt-with Fifth Prince Tubeppa and Sixth Prince Tyson.
